1. Anne Hathaway’s Background
Anne Hathaway was born on November 12, 1982, in Brooklyn, New York. Raised in a supportive and academically-oriented household, Hathaway showed an early interest in the arts. She pursued acting seriously, eventually studying at the American Academy of Dramatic Arts and Vassar College, where she majored in English and political science. Her educational background and acting training laid the foundation for her successful career in Hollywood.
